Upon recommendation of the Secretary of Environment and Natural Resources, and by virtue of the powers vested in me by law,
I, GLORIA MACAPAGAL-ARROYO, President of the Republic of the Philippines, do hereby withdraw from sale or settlement, and reserve for multi-purpose plaza site purposes of Barangay Bagumbayan, Municipality of Lupon, Province of Davao Oriental, Island of Mindanao, under the Administration of the Interior and Local Government, subject to private rights, if any there be, certain parcel of land of the public domain situated in Barangay Bagumbayan, Municipality of Lupon, Province of Davao Oriental, Island of Mindanao, which parcel is more particularly described as follows:
LOT 71, Ccs-11-000612
portion of Lots 173 and 174, Gss-11-059
(Bagumbayan Multi-Purpose Plaza)
A parcel of land known as Lot 71, Ccs-11-000612, a portion of Lots 173 and 174, Gss-11-059, situated in Barangay Bagumbayan, Municipality of Lupon, Province of Davao Oriental, Island of Mindanao. Bounded on the NW., N., and NE., along lines 3-4-5-6 by Lot 164 (Road) Ccs-11-000612; on the E., along line 6-7 by National Highway (60.00 m. wide); on the S., along line 7-1 by Lot 70; along line 1-2 by Lot 69, all of Ccs-11-000612; and on the W., along line 2-3 by existing road.
